Gingerbread Men Chain Instructions



Items Needed:

-Brown Construction Paper
-Brown, Red, Black and White Marker (If you have white ribbon, you can substitute that where the white marker is used)
-Silver, Red, Yellow, Green and Blue Glitter Glue
-Scissors
-Tape

Instructions:

-Tape two pieces of brown paper together. (This will make 5 gingerbread men - if you would like more, just keep adding paper)
-Fold the paper back and forth, using the square on the template below to determine the width of the folds.
-Cut the top and bottom to be the same size as the square on the template.
-Cut the gingerbread man out of the template. Trace him on the top of the brown paper. Cut him out.
-Open up the chain.
-Using the brown marker, draw hair and a nose on each of the men. Using the black maker draw eyes on each of the men. Using the red marker, draw a smile on each of the men.
-Using the white marker, draw cuffs on each arm and each leg. (If you have white ribbon, just glue that on.
-Using a different color of glitter glue (repeating one color), draw 3 buttons going down the belly's of the gingerbread men.
-Using the silver glitter glue, draw a bow tie on each of the men.
